• Refine Query
  • Source
  • Publication year
  • to
  • Language
  • 557
  • 231
  • 139
  • 127
  • 110
  • 68
  • 65
  • 43
  • 30
  • 24
  • 19
  • 14
  • 10
  • 9
  • 8
  • Tagged with
  • 1548
  • 408
  • 263
  • 240
  • 233
  • 231
  • 226
  • 213
  • 171
  • 155
  • 145
  • 131
  • 127
  • 120
  • 112
  • About
  • The Global ETD Search service is a free service for researchers to find electronic theses and dissertations. This service is provided by the Networked Digital Library of Theses and Dissertations.
    Our metadata is collected from universities around the world. If you manage a university/consortium/country archive and want to be added, details can be found on the NDLTD website.
491

A method for mapping XML-based specifications between development methodologies

Huang, Fei 17 April 2009 (has links)
The Unified Modeling Language (UML) is widely used by software engineers as the basis of analysis and design in software development. However, UML ignores human factors in the course of software development because of its strong emphasis on the internal structure and functionality of the application. This thesis presents a method of mapping human-computer interaction (HCI) requirement specifications generated by usability engineering (UE) methodologies (e.g. Putting Usability First (PUF)) into UML specifications. These two sets of requirement specification are specified, using Extensible Markup Language (XML) so that HCI requirement specifications can be integrated into UML ones. A Mapping Tool was developed to facilitate the creation of mappings between PUF XML tags and XMI tags. The Mapping Tool was used to create mappings between PUF and UML requirement specifications. This mapping process and its outputs were evaluated to demonstrate that the tool worked. The results of the evaluation show that the HCI requirement specification represented by the PUF XML tags can improve the UML specification by adding them into the XMI tags.
492

The Graphic Authoring Platform of Screenplays for Robotic Puppet Shows

Siao, Jhih-Jhong 12 September 2012 (has links)
With the development of the network, people are increasingly used to exchanging information on the Internet. Therefore, the capability of robot controller should not be limited to control robots locally. The objective of this thesis is to provide a system, the screenplay based performance platform of Robotic puppet shows (SBPP), commanding multiple robots; each robot performing its own role based on a script composed by the developed authoring tool. Wherever and whenever a user wants to use SBPP, he/she just needs connect to the network and begins to design a script. SBPP consists of three parts: the graphic authoring platform (GAP) of screenplays for robotic puppet shows, the screenplay interpreter (SI) for multi-morphic robots, and robots themself. The work of this thesis is concentrated on the implementation of the GAP and robots (model: DARwIn-OP) control. The GAP provides options for a variety of robots to users. The users can easily design their own robot scripts merely by drag-and-drop operating on icons representing the actions, behavior, and short scripts, respectively. Whenever a script is created or updated, GAP will automatically save the script as an XML file format internally. In addition, robots can be conducted to express their emotions orally by utter the lines composed. The system is demonstrated by a play of ¡§do-as-I-do¡¨ and recoded in a video at YouTube:¡¨ http://www.youtube.com/watch?v=v8ErTOgAQSo¡¨.
493

Hur kan XML underlätta e-handel?

Axelsson, Peter January 2000 (has links)
<p>Detta examensarbete har inriktats mot XML och dess användning på Internet. Frågeställningen lyder: "Kan underhållet av presenterad information på WWW förbättras eller förenklas med hjälp av XML för ett e-handelsföretag?" Det som förväntades av detta arbete är att se om XML kan ersätta HTML och underlätta för personalen vid uppdateringar av e-handelsplatsen. Bakgrunden till arbetet är att underhållet av en webbhandelsplats i dagens läge kräver mycket manuellt arbete och kostar mycket pengar. Går det att minska det manuella arbetet kan pengar sparas. Till grund för arbetet ligger en litteraturstudie.</p><p>Kortfattat var resultatet följande:</p><p>·Kraven på serverprestanda kan sänkas m.h.a. XML.</p><p>·Tiden som läggs på uppdateringar av innehåll och utseende av webbplatser kan minskas.</p><p>·Kopplingen mellan befintligt affärssystem och webbhandelplats kan förenklas.</p><p>·Svaret på problemformuleringen är ja. XML ger ovan nämnda förbättringar och detta motiverar till att byta från ett HTML-baserat system till ett XML-baserat.</p>
494

Studie av olika alternativ för elektronisk handel

Jonsson, Martin January 2000 (has links)
<p>Detta arbete behandlar elektronisk handel, EDI, i olika utförande. Min tanke med arbetet var att företag som visar intresse för elektronisk handel skulle kunna få en hjälp med jämförelse mellan olika alternativ. De alternativ jag behandlar är web EDI, EDIFACT och EDIFACT med stöd för XML. När jag jämfört systemen har jag tittat på i första hand fyra huvud frågor, kostnad, kompetenskrav hos kunden (för att sköta systemet), implementeringstid och säkerhet som finns i systemet. Sammanlagt har jag undersökt fyra olika system från fyra olika leverantörer. För att bekräfta leverantörernas uppgifter runt systemen har jag även kontaktat kunder som använder respektive system. Som avslutning sammanfattar jag de olika systemen med utgångspunkt från min frågeställning.</p>
495

Är XML redo att tillämpas?

Olofsson, Lars January 2000 (has links)
<p>XML är ett märkordsspråk som utvecklats för att dels komplettera och ersätta HTML-baserade system och dels för att möjliggöra tillgänglighet för Webben på nya plattformar och miljöer. XML är en arvtagare till SGML och på motsvarande sätt ett metaspråk. XML erbjuder möjligheter att utveckla egna element, attribut och entiteter samt möjligheter att definiera egna dokumentstrukturer.</p><p>XML tar sikte på att implementeras i webbtillgängliga gränssnitt och kommer i sådana system även att få en datalagrande funktion, åtminstone enligt hur XML-standarden för närvarande är definierad. I detta sammanhang är det därför intressant att jämföra XML med de befintliga RDBHS som sedan ett flertal år bygger upp datalagrande funktioner i webbtillgängliga gränssnitt. Denna rapport redogör för ett projekt där XML prövats som datalagringsteknik och då ur perspektiv av ett RDBHS-baserat och webbtillgängligt prototypsystem.</p><p>Resultatet visar att XML inte kan implementeras på motsvarande sätt som RDBHS och att XML som datalagringsteknik bör ifrågasättas. Orsaken står att finna i att XML:s datamodell identifieras som hierarkisk och att XML därvidlag lider av denna datamodells brister i jämförelse med RDBHS relationsdatamodell. Vidare föreligger ett antal praktiska problem vilka har sin orsak i att det ännu inte har implementerats något kommersiellt tillgängligt DBHS för XML. Denna rapport redogör dock för förslag till lösning på XML:s brister som datalagrare. Det principiella lösningsförslaget går ut på att transformera XML:s hierarkiska datamodell till en objektorienterad datamodell. På så sätt kan DBHS-funktionalitet möjliggöras via ODBHS, eller så kan objektorienterad åtkomst av XML-data möjliggöras via objektorienterade programspråk.</p>
496

Användarberoende vyer av XML-data

Källstrand, Thomas January 2001 (has links)
<p>I rapporten undersöks vilka möjligheter användarberoende vyer av XML-data kan ge i webbmiljö. Undersökningen omfattar dels att ta reda på vad en användare vill ha möjlighet att kunna visa eller påverka i en dynamisk vy, och dels vilka av dessa egenskaper som kan uppnås med hjälp av stilmallar i XSL. Med dynamiska vyer skall det gå lättare att förändra och skapa rapporter som passar den enskilde användarens behov, det vill säga en mer lättläst och överskådlig version. Vad som framkommer av rapporten är vilka egenskaper som en användare vill ha i en dynamisk vy. Ett antal existensbevis i form av exempel visar också vilka av dessa som går att lösa. Som komplement framställdes en enkel prototyp som hanterar dynamiska vyer.</p>
497

Utvärdering av XML:s framtida möjligheter

Lindhe, Emelie January 2001 (has links)
<p>Detta examensarbete utvärderar XML:s framtida möjligheter. XML är ett dynamiskt markeringsspråk som är tänkt att lösa många av HTML:s brister. Hittills har markeringsspråket fått mycket positiv kritik, men i och med att XML fortfarande inte har slagit igenom helt är dess framtid fortfarande oviss.</p><p>En undersökning av tidigare produkt- och teknikintroduktioner i samhället resulterar i ett ramverk bestående av faktorer som kan påverka produkter/tekniker vid en introduktion på marknaden. Detta ramverk jämförs sedan med XML för att se i vilken omfattning XML uppfyller ramverkets faktorer.</p><p>Vidare undersöks tre produkt- och teknikutvecklingsmetoder, vilket resulterar i att de utvecklingsfaser som ses som extra viktiga vid produkt- och teknikutveckling tas fram. Dessa faser fungerar som en mall då XML:s utvecklingsprocess studeras.</p><p>Ovanstående undersökningar genomförs som litteraturstudie. Utvärderingen visar att XML inte följer ramverkets och produktutvecklingsmetodernas mönster fullt ut. Detta resultat ligger sedan till grund för analys av XML:s framtidsutsikter.</p>
498

Nätverksfördröjningar vid tillämpning av SOAP

Björk, Stefan January 2002 (has links)
<p>Denna studie undersöker om, och isåfall hur, nätverksfördröjningar uppstår då små SOAP-meddelanden skickas över TCP/IP. För att utföra detta skapades ett litet nätverk och i det genomfördes mätning av svarstider för två olika SOAP-implementationer, Apache SOAP och Microsoft SOAP Toolkit. Resultaten från mätningarna analyserades och visade att det uppstår nätverksfördröjningar då små SOAP-meddelanden skickas över TCP/IP. Både Apache SOAP och Microsoft SOAP Toolkit uppvisade olika strategier i nätverkskommunikationen vilket påverkade svarstider. För Apache SOAP uppstod fördröjningar vid varje SOAP-anrop, oberoende av storleken på meddelandet som returnerades, medan Microsoft SOAP Toolkit undvek nätverksfördröjningar då meddelandet som returnerades var tillräckligt stort.</p>
499

Begränsningar för molekylärbiologisk data i databaser

Hanson Rodin, Kristoffer January 2002 (has links)
<p>De senaste åren har molekylärbiologisk data växt explosionsartat. Ny teknik gör att information kan härledas ur data snabbare och mer än tidigare. Faktum är att det tillkommer så mycket ny data att de nya resultaten inte längre kan publiceras i artiklar. Dessa sekvenser av data finns istället bara åtkomliga i speciella databaser. Dessa databaser är tillgängliga för allmänheten dels genom att ladda ned dem eller att använda en Internet browser.</p><p>Det har, för ett par år sedan, kommit en ny standard för att strukturera upp och lagra data på. Detta nya sätt är XML. Det har föreslagits att XML skall ersätta eller ta över delar av de databaser som finns då XML skall vara ett bättre sätt att strukturera upp och lagra molekylärbiologisk data.</p><p>Det finns däremot inga forskningar som direkt har undersökt hur bra XML är jämte andra databaser när det gäller Molekylärbiologisk data.</p><p>Detta arbete skall ge en närmare inblick i hur bra databaser och XML kan hantera representation och lagring av sekvensdata som DNA och proteiner, då data av den sorten innehåller väldigt mycket information och är svår att representera.</p><p>Resultaten kommer att visa att XML inte är riktigt tillräckligt bra för att ersätta de äldre databaserna. Resultaten kommer dessutom också att visa att de äldre databaserna, även om de är de bästa för tillfället, inte är perfekta för ändamålet att lagra sekvensdata.</p>
500

Val av lagringsstrategi för XML-data

Lans, Hasse January 2002 (has links)
<p>XML är ett markeringsspråk som var tänkt att ta över efter HTML på webben, men som fått ett stort antal andra användningsfunktioner. Bland annat som format för att överföra information. I samband med att XML används för detta uppstår frågan på vilket sätt som de XML-dokument som blivit resultatet av informationsöverföring bör lagras.</p><p>Detta examensarbete utvärderar hur XML-dokument som är resultatet av informationsöverföring bör lagras. Arbetets syfte var att undersöka i vilka situationer företag idag använder sig av XML för informationsöverföring, vilka faktorer det finns att ta hänsyn till vid lagring av XML-dokument och vilken lagringsstrategi som ett företag bör välja i en speciell situation.</p><p>Ovanstående undersökningar genomförs genom en kombination av litteraturstudie samt enkät och intervju.</p><p>På grund av att antalet företag som gick att uppbringa som använde sig av XML för informationsöverföring var allt för få för att några slutsatser om situationer där företagen använder sig av XML för informationsöverföring skulle kunna dras övergavs den delen av arbetet.</p><p>Däremot utkristalliserades tre sätt att lagra XML-data som verkade lämpliga. De tre sätten är; som en textfil i en dokumentstruktur, i en relationsdatabas (antingen som attribut i databasen eller som BLOB:ar) respektive i en XML-databas. Beroende av vilka krav och önskemål ett företag har på sin lagring är respektive sätt mer eller mindre lämpligt i den enskilda situationen.</p>

Page generated in 0.0404 seconds